There is a task called msdtc.exe running and its taking up 100% of the memory. The problem is it's not letting me run any applications or even log off and shut down! None of the start-up applications are running. When I click a .exe file it doesn't open. Is msdtc.exe spyware? Can anyone help???
 
msdtc.exe is the Microsoft Distributed Transaction Coordinator. The process is loaded into the system by Microsoft Personal Web Server and Microsoft SQL Server. The service is used to manage transactions across multiple servers.
